Megosztás a következőn keresztül:


Megfigyelhetőség az Azure Container alkalmazásokban

Az Azure Container Apps számos beépített megfigyelhetőségi funkciót biztosít, amelyek együttesen holisztikus képet adnak a konténeralkalmazás állapotáról az alkalmazás teljes életciklusa alatt. Ezek a funkciók segítenek nyomon követni és diagnosztizálni az alkalmazás állapotát a teljesítmény javítása, valamint a trendekre és kritikus problémákra való reagálás érdekében.

Ezek a funkciók a következők:

Szolgáltatás Leírás
Naplóstreamelés Közel valós időben tekintheti meg a streamelési rendszert és a konzolnaplókat egy tárolóból.
Tárolókonzol Csatlakozás a tárolók Linux-konzoljára az alkalmazás tárolón belüli hibakereséséhez.
Azure Monitor-metrikák Az alkalmazás számítási és hálózati használatának megtekintése és elemzése metrikaadatokon keresztül.
Alkalmazásnaplózás Az alkalmazás figyelése, elemzése és hibakeresése naplóadatok használatával.
Azure Monitor Log Analytics Lekérdezések futtatásával megtekintheti és elemezheti az alkalmazás rendszer- és alkalmazásnaplóit.
Azure Monitor-riasztások Riasztások létrehozása és kezelése az eseményekről és a feltételekről a metrikák és a naplóadatok alapján.

Feljegyzés

Bár nem beépített funkció, az Azure Monitor Alkalmazás Elemzések hatékony eszköz a webes és háttéralkalmazások monitorozására. Bár a Container Apps nem támogatja az alkalmazás Elemzések automatikus rendszerállapot-ügynököt, az alkalmazáskódot az Alkalmazás Elemzések SDK-k használatával is rendszerezheti.

Az alkalmazás életciklusának megfigyelhetősége

A Container Apps megfigyelhetőségi funkcióival az alkalmazást a fejlesztés és az éles környezet teljes életciklusa alatt figyelheti. Az alábbi szakaszok az egyes fázisok leghatékonyabb monitorozási funkcióit ismertetik.

Fejlesztés és tesztelés

A fejlesztési és tesztelési fázisban a tárolók alkalmazásnaplóihoz és konzoljához való valós idejű hozzáférés kritikus fontosságú a hibakeresési problémákhoz. A Container Apps a következő lehetőségeket biztosítja:

  • Naplóstreamelés: Valós idejű naplóstreamek megtekintése a tárolókból.
  • Tárolókonzol: A tárolókonzol elérése az alkalmazás hibakereséséhez.

Telepítés

A tárolóalkalmazás üzembe helyezése után a folyamatos figyelés segítségével gyorsan azonosíthatja a hibaarányok, a teljesítmény és az erőforrás-felhasználás körüli problémákat.

Az Azure Monitor lehetővé teszi az alkalmazás nyomon követését az alábbi funkciókkal:

Karbantartás

A Container Apps korrektúra létrehozásával kezeli a tárolóalkalmazás frissítéseit. Egyszerre több változatot is futtathat kék zöld környezetekben, vagy A/B-tesztelést végezhet. Ezek a megfigyelhetőségi funkciók segítenek az alkalmazás korrektúrák közötti monitorozásában:

Következő lépések